Our research suggests eating an unhealthy breakfast could have a similar effect on your child’s school day as having nothing at all

By Andrew J. Martin, Scientia Professor and Professor of Educational Psychology, UNSW Sydney
Emma Burns, ARC DECRA Fellow and Senior Lecturer, Macquarie University
Joel Pearson, Professor of cognitive neuroscience, UNSW Sydney
Keiko C.P. Bostwick, Postdoctoral research fellow, UNSW Sydney
Roger Kennett, Researcher in educational neuroscience, UNSW Sydney
In our new research we looked at what impact breakfast has on students’ motivation to learn and their academic achievement.The Conversation
